📺 Статьи

Как написать формулу IF в Excel

Функция ЕСЛИ в Excel — это как волшебная палочка, которая позволяет автоматизировать принятие решений прямо в ваших таблицах. Представьте: вы задаете условие, а Excel сам определяет, что делать, если оно выполняется, и что делать, если нет! 🪄

  1. Что такое функция ЕСЛИ и зачем она нужна? 🤔
  2. Базовый синтаксис функции ЕСЛИ 🧱
  3. excel
  4. Простые примеры использования функции ЕСЛИ 🍎
  5. Пример 1: Проверка выполнения плана продаж
  6. excel
  7. Пример 2: Расчет скидки в зависимости от суммы покупки
  8. excel
  9. Усложняем задачу: функция ЕСЛИ с несколькими условиями 🧠
  10. Пример 3: Проверка выполнения плана продаж по двум товарам
  11. excel
  12. Пример 4: Предоставление скидки по промокоду или при покупке от определенной суммы
  13. excel
  14. Вложенные функции ЕСЛИ: создаем многоуровневые условия 🏗️
  15. Пример 5: Оценка успеваемости студентов
  16. excel
  17. Полезные советы по работе с функцией ЕСЛИ 💡
  18. Заключение 🎉
  19. FAQ ❓

Что такое функция ЕСЛИ и зачем она нужна? 🤔

Функция ЕСЛИ — это логическая функция, которая анализирует данные в ячейке и, в зависимости от результата, выполняет то или иное действие. Проще говоря, вы говорите Excel: «ЕСЛИ в этой ячейке вот такое значение, ТО сделай вот это, А ЕСЛИ другое значение, ТО сделай вот это».

Это невероятно удобно для:

  • Автоматизации анализа данных: Вместо того, чтобы вручную проверять каждую ячейку, вы можете использовать ЕСЛИ для выделения нужной информации. Например, подсветить красным цветом ячейки с просроченными задачами или выделить зеленым цветом клиентов, сделавших покупки на сумму более 10 000 рублей.
  • Упрощения сложных расчетов: ЕСЛИ позволяет создавать многоуровневые формулы, которые учитывают сразу несколько условий.
  • Создания интерактивных таблиц: Вы можете использовать ЕСЛИ для создания выпадающих списков, динамических диаграмм и других элементов, которые делают ваши таблицы более удобными и наглядными.

Базовый синтаксис функции ЕСЛИ 🧱

Формула ЕСЛИ в Excel всегда имеет одну и ту же структуру:

excel

=ЕСЛИ(логическое_выражение; значение_если_истина; значение_если_ложь)

Разберем каждый элемент формулы подробнее:

  • логическое_выражение: Это условие, которое проверяет функция ЕСЛИ. Оно может быть простым (например, A1>100) или сложным, включающим в себя функции, операторы сравнения и ссылки на другие ячейки.
  • значение_если_истина: Это действие, которое выполняется, если логическое_выражение возвращает значение ИСТИНА. Это может быть число, текст, формула или даже другая функция.
  • значение_если_ложь: Это действие, которое выполняется, если логическое_выражение возвращает значение ЛОЖЬ.

Простые примеры использования функции ЕСЛИ 🍎

Давайте рассмотрим несколько простых примеров, чтобы понять, как работает функция ЕСЛИ на практике:

Пример 1: Проверка выполнения плана продаж

Представьте, что у вас есть таблица с данными о продажах менеджеров. Вы хотите выделить цветом тех, кто выполнил план, и тех, кто не выполнил. В столбце A у вас указаны имена менеджеров, в столбце B — их план продаж, а в столбце C — фактические продажи.

Формула ЕСЛИ будет выглядеть так:

excel

=ЕСЛИ(C2>B2;«План выполнен»;«План не выполнен»)

Эта формула проверяет, больше ли значение в ячейке C2 (фактические продажи) значения в ячейке B2 (план продаж). Если да, то формула возвращает текст «План выполнен», если нет — «План не выполнен».

Пример 2: Расчет скидки в зависимости от суммы покупки

Допустим, у вас есть интернет-магазин, и вы хотите предоставить скидку покупателям, которые потратили больше определенной суммы. В столбце A у вас указаны суммы покупок, а в столбце B вы хотите рассчитать скидку.

Формула ЕСЛИ будет выглядеть так:

excel

=ЕСЛИ(A2>5000;A2*0.1;0)

Эта формула проверяет, больше ли значение в ячейке A2 (сумма покупки) 5000. Если да, то формула возвращает значение скидки (10% от суммы покупки), если нет — 0.

Усложняем задачу: функция ЕСЛИ с несколькими условиями 🧠

Иногда нам нужно проверить не одно, а сразу несколько условий. В этом случае нам на помощь приходят логические операторы И и ИЛИ.

  • Оператор И возвращает значение ИСТИНА, только если все переданные ему условия истинны.
  • Оператор ИЛИ возвращает значение ИСТИНА, если хотя бы одно из переданных ему условий истинно.

Пример 3: Проверка выполнения плана продаж по двум товарам

Вернемся к примеру с менеджерами по продажам. Теперь мы хотим проверить, выполнили ли менеджеры план по двум товарам: A и B. В столбце D у нас указаны продажи товара A, а в столбце E — продажи товара B.

Формула ЕСЛИ с оператором И будет выглядеть так:

excel

=ЕСЛИ(И(D2>B2;E2>C2);«План выполнен по обоим товарам»;«План не выполнен»)

Эта формула проверяет два условия:

  1. Продажи товара A (D2) больше плана по товару A (B2).
  2. Продажи товара B (E2) больше плана по товару B (C2).

Только если оба условия истинны, формула возвращает текст «План выполнен по обоим товарам». В противном случае — «План не выполнен».

Пример 4: Предоставление скидки по промокоду или при покупке от определенной суммы

Допустим, в нашем интернет-магазине действует акция: скидка предоставляется либо при вводе промокода, либо при покупке от определенной суммы. В столбце C у нас указан промокод (если он есть), а в столбце D мы хотим рассчитать скидку.

Формула ЕСЛИ с оператором ИЛИ будет выглядеть так:

excel

=ЕСЛИ(ИЛИ(C2="ПРОМО2023";A2>3000);A2*0.15;0)

Эта формула проверяет два условия:

  1. В ячейке C2 указан промокод "ПРОМО2023".
  2. Сумма покупки (A2) больше 3000.

Если хотя бы одно из условий истинно, формула возвращает значение скидки (15% от суммы покупки). В противном случае — 0.

Вложенные функции ЕСЛИ: создаем многоуровневые условия 🏗️

Функции ЕСЛИ можно вкладывать друг в друга, создавая сложные условия с множеством вариантов развития событий.

Пример 5: Оценка успеваемости студентов

Представьте, что у вас есть таблица с оценками студентов. Вы хотите автоматически проставлять им оценки по системе «отлично», «хорошо», «удовлетворительно», «неудовлетворительно». В столбце A у вас указаны баллы студентов, а в столбце B вы хотите проставить оценки.

Формула ЕСЛИ с вложенными условиями будет выглядеть так:

excel

=ЕСЛИ(A2>=90;«отлично»;ЕСЛИ(A2>=75;«хорошо»;ЕСЛИ(A2>=60;«удовлетворительно»;«неудовлетворительно»)))

Разберем эту формулу по шагам:

  1. Сначала проверяется условие A2>=90. Если оно истинно, то студент получает оценку «отлично».
  2. Если первое условие ложно, то проверяется следующее условие: A2>=75. Если оно истинно, то студент получает оценку «хорошо».
  3. Если второе условие тоже ложно, то проверяется третье условие: A2>=60. Если оно истинно, то студент получает оценку «удовлетворительно».
  4. Если все три условия ложны, то студент получает оценку «неудовлетворительно».

Полезные советы по работе с функцией ЕСЛИ 💡

  • Используйте форматирование: Выделяйте цветом ячейки с разными результатами функции ЕСЛИ, чтобы сделать вашу таблицу более наглядной.
  • Не забывайте про кавычки: Текстовые значения в функции ЕСЛИ всегда заключаются в двойные кавычки.
  • Проверяйте свои формулы: Перед тем как применять функцию ЕСЛИ к большому объему данных, убедитесь, что она работает корректно на небольшом примере.

Заключение 🎉

Функция ЕСЛИ — это мощный инструмент, который позволяет автоматизировать принятие решений в Excel. Освоив ее, вы сможете создавать более сложные и функциональные таблицы, которые сэкономят вам время и силы.

FAQ ❓

  • Что делать, если функция ЕСЛИ возвращает ошибку? Проверьте правильность написания формулы, а также убедитесь, что все используемые в ней ссылки на ячейки корректны.
  • Можно ли использовать функцию ЕСЛИ с другими функциями Excel? Да, конечно! Функцию ЕСЛИ можно использовать с большинством других функций Excel, создавая сложные и мощные формулы.
  • Где можно найти больше примеров использования функции ЕСЛИ? В интернете существует множество ресурсов с примерами и уроками по функции ЕСЛИ. Вы можете найти их, введя в поисковике "Примеры функции ЕСЛИ в Excel".
Вверх